Steve Schmidt, a longtime Republican political strategist who renounced his membership in the party in 2018, left his role as an MSNBC contributor in early 2019 to advise former Starbucks CEO Howard Schultz on his potential presidential bid. MSNBClegal expert Barbara McQuade, political analyst Richard Stengel and health expert Dr Ezekiel Emanuel will no longer serve as paid commentators for the network after joining the president-elect's new transition team, sources told DailyMail.com on Wednesday. These so-called contributors are essentially paid guests who sign contracts to appear exclusively on one network (or family of networks), generally agreeing to go on-air as frequently as the news cycle demands. But, they exist in a sort of gray zone between full-time employees and unpaid interviewees, which makes discerning what they are allowed to say and do off-camera challenging.
